Paper Flower Wall Décor

About a year ago, Connie from Creatively Renewed completed a neutral, tranquil makeover of her master bedroom.

Although she still loves the space, Connie has been looking for ways to add splashes of color and was inspired to create artwork for the empty wall above her dresser.

Connie repurposed a set of wall canvases from the Goodwill and then created paper dahlias using a roll of wrapping paper she had on hand.

A coat of spray paint finished off the dahlias and gave them just the pop of color Connie was craving!
